On August 4, 2025, Praxis Precision Medicines, Inc. issued a press release announcing its financial results for the second quarter of 2025. In addition to its financial disclosures, the Company reported mid-stage clinical trial results for its anti-seizure medication, vormatrigine. Praxis disclosed that 36 of 61 patients experienced treatment-emergent adverse events, and nearly 25% of study participants discontinued participation.
Following this announcement, Praxis’s stock price declined by $3.00 per share, or approximately 5.55%, closing at $51.09 per share on August 4, 2025.
